Abstract(in English) Cognitive Wireless Cloud (CWC) architecture includes cognitive radio technology which enables mobile users to sense and to connect to different radio networks. Providing QoS support for seamless mobile networking in Cognitive Wireless Cloud is a technical challenge. In general, resource reservations are required in all possible next destinations of the mobile user, which dereasing the number of users that the system can simultaneously support, therefore lowering the total capacity of the system. This paper shows an efficient resource reservation scheme by studying the suitable reservation duration and suitable radio network for making resource reservation. The proposed scheme based on dwell time in a service area which can be estimated from user's mobility information such that moving speed.
